rancher / dashboard

The Rancher UI
https://rancher.com
Apache License 2.0
450 stars 256 forks source link

When you choose to customize project/cluster permissions, the UI reports an error when adding project/cluster members #10894

Open ly5156 opened 4 months ago

ly5156 commented 4 months ago

Setup

Describe the bug

When you choose to customize project/cluseter permissions, the UI reports an error when adding project/cluster members, if Simplified Chinese is selected

To Reproduce

  1. Switch UI language to Simplified Chinese: Preferences -> languages-> 简体中文

Add project members

  1. Go to the Projects/Namespaces page, and on the project row,click on the Edit Config menu
  2. On the member tab page, click the Add button
  3. In the Project Permissions section, select Custom Option

Add cluster members

  1. Go to the Cluster and Project Members page, and select Cluster Membership tab,click Add button
  2. In the Cluster Permissions section, select Custom Option

Result UI goes to error page or UI is not responding

Expected Result

Show project/cluster customization permission options

Screenshots

test test1

Additional context

richard-cox commented 1 month ago

/backport v2.9.next2